"Riverboat - A Very Special Ant" by Tanya Maneki tells the heartwarming story of an adventurous ant named Arlo. Set on a picturesque riverboat, Arlo dreams of exploring beyond the confines of his anthill and discovering the world. Accompanied by his loyal friends, he embarks on a journey filled with challenges and new friendships. Through teamwork and courage, they navigate through exciting adventures, learning valuable lessons about kindness, resilience, and the importance of believing in oneself. Arlo’s quest not only changes his perspective but also inspires his fellow ants to chase their dreams, emphasizing the strength found in unity and friendship.
